Pengaruh Pemilihan Anti-Psikotik Pada Pasien Depresi Tanpa dan Dengan Gejala Psikotik Terhadap Lama Hari Rawat Inap
Abstract
Antipsychotic therapy is given frequently to the patient with depressive symptoms. Antipsychotics are used to enhance the effects of antidepressants in the depressive patients. The aim of this study was to evaluate the length of stay of antipsychotic therapy selection in the depressive patient without/with psychosis symptoms. This study was conducted by quantitative method, multicenter, non-experimental approach, and cohort design study. Data were collected from medical records of 187 patients diagnosed with depression without/with psychosis symptoms from the various mental-illness hospital in Central Java Province. There was a significant difference (p <0.05) in the length of stay with the selection of antidepressants in depressive patients without psychotic symptoms, and there was no significant difference (p> 0.05) in the length of stay with the selection of antipsychotic agents in depressive patients without/with psychotic symptoms.
Keywords— Length of stay, depression, without/with psychosis symptoms, antipsychotic
